11/5 late Friday evening our father Raul Elizalde Hernández suffered a heart attack and a fall to the head and passed away. Raul was a father to 3 children. He leaves them behind along with his life long partner/wife Margarita, grandchild, his brothers, sisters and parents. He was 65 and full of life! Grateful for his second chance at life after going through surgery for his prostate cancer. With plans to buy a home and focus his time to his wife, grandchild, plants and his hobbies (art, music, eating.) He was born in Mexico and grew up in an community we’re going to school was not heard of. His father encouraged him to go to school and so he went and made it all the way to University UNAM. There he studied architecture and graphic design. He worked at MClant Erickson an ad agency as a designer. He was a hard worker and build his parents a house. He then met the love of his life Margarita and they then moved to the USA. There his credentials were not validated so he grabbed a job as a busser. Took the bus to work and never missed a single day of work. At 34 he had his first child Alba. By then he worked at the regeant in Beverly Hills running the mini bar cart. He met a lot of famous people. Then at 36 he had his second son David and at 38 his third one Jessie. He loved his children and raised them with good manners. Teaching them to be hard workers and to always smile. Raul had the most contagious and beautiful smile. He loved queen but his idol was Jim Morrison. In 2017 he finally became a U.S. citizen a big dream of his. He traveled California and got to visit his parent in Mexico at least 3-4 times in the past years. Even though he had just retired he was ready to start working again after he felt better from his surgery and wanted to buy his house. Wanting to be a better person.
